The Skywin Inflatable Air Tent is a spacious, quick-to-inflate playhouse designed for kids aged 3 and up. Measuring 77" x 50", it offers a breathable polyester environment with a fun camo star print, perfect for group or solo imaginative play. Setup is effortless with any household box fan (not included), and safety features like a mesh tunnel keep kids protected while they enjoy hours of comfortable, creative fun.

I got this for 6 middle school boys having a sleep over in my house. I am 5’9 and can sit with my legs extended no problem. I like that it has no poles or wires to keep it up, my kids usually destroy play tents with those. I will update with durability after the sleepover. It was easy to set up. And it popped up almost immediately after turning the fan on. With the high speed and no one inside a small section tries to billow up, lower the fan speed and it does a lot better. It has little weight bags attached to it around the bottom that keep most of the walls weighed down. Edit to update: this has survived several middle school boy nerf gun fights. It has held up the best so far and there were times I was questioning my sanity allowing the boys to utilize the forts.
